Released in 1989, the ensoniq vfx synthesizer was ensoniq's early take on wavetables, called transwaves in ensoniqs' perlance. The machine was a digital six oscillator hybrid rompler and additive with several of the waveforms being wavetables. Modulation settings allowed you to scan thru the waveforms for evolving sounds such as this pad. The vfx-sd was much the same synthesizer, but added a sequencer.

The bronze temple bell of the byodo-in temple in the valley of the temples cemetery just outside kaneohe, hawaii. The bell was cast in japan and had been installed in a free standing bell tower, as is customary in japan, and can be rung by anyone who passes by. It's timbre and sound reminded me very much of the bronze bell in hiroshima called the peace bell, which is in a tower directly across the river from the technical school ruins.

Here's a vocal sample of "hydrochloric acid" ran through audioterm and sent to a waldorf blofeld as a wavetable. The blofeld pitches up and then scans the wavetable (via mod wheel, so it's fun), which plays out what you hear here, plus a fair bit of outboard verb. Sounds like a vocoder but it's not. As opposed to traditional samplers the pitch is independent of the playback rate / length of the sample.
